The expert stated problems with receiving therapy for orphan patients
The main problems with receiving complex therapy and supervision from specialists in Russia are experienced by adult patients with orphan diagnoses, the chairman of the Board of the All-Russian Society of Orphan Diseases told Izvestia Irina Myasnikova.
"According to a survey conducted by the BOE and the All–Russian Union of Patients, among 494 adult patients and 187 of their representatives from 73 regions, which we conducted in January — February 2026, no more than 21.4% of adult orphan patients receive comprehensive treatment and supervision from several specialists at once," she said.
At the same time, such treatment is absolutely necessary for them, since it allows them to ensure holistic health monitoring and timely respond to emerging complications, the expert emphasized.
Access to life-saving therapy, rehabilitation and necessary social benefits opens up the status of a disabled person, said the interlocutor of the editorial office. But not everyone has it.
Graduates of the Circle of Goodness Foundation often face the problem of receiving preferential treatment, Myasnikova added. Thanks to free therapy in childhood, they are in a so—called compensated state, and leaving the "Circle of Goodness" often interrupts this lifelong therapy - and this negates previously achieved results.
